 Prototype  Debuts Behind  The Sims 3  In The U.K.

Although U.K. sales of Electronic Arts' The Sims 3 for PC dropped 48 percent week-on-week, the game was still able to hold off the launch of the Activision Blizzard game Prototype, Chart-Track said Monday.

The Sims 3 topped the all-platform charts for the week ended June 13, followed by Prototype, which launched on Xbox 360 and PlayStation 3. On Chart-Track's individual platform sales charts, The Sims 3 was on top, with the Xbox 360 version of Prototype following in second place.

The Sims 3 launched a week prior to Prototype, debuting in the number one spot. The Sims franchise has sold over 100 million units worldwide to date.

Prototype for Xbox 360 and PS3 were the only new two brand new SKUs in the top 10 during the week, although EA Sports' new Wii MotionPlus-compatible Grand Slam Tennis debuted at number 12.

Falling out of the top 10 from last week was the PS3 version of THQ's Red Faction: Guerrilla and Activision Blizzard's Guitar Hero: Metallica for Xbox 360.

The PS3-exclusive Infamous broke the top 10 for another week, dropping from six to nine on the chart. Exercise games Wii Fit and EA Sports Active also were in the top 10.

Below are the unit sales rankings for individual platforms for the week ended June 13:
